The Basics of Fire Sprinkler Systems
A fire sprinkler system is an automated fire suppression system made to manage or snuff out fires before they spread out. Unlike what many people think, these systems do not activate simultaneously. Instead, they react independently to warm in the damaged area, protecting against unnecessary water damage and effectively consisting of the fire.
These systems contain a supply of water, piping, and sprinkler heads tactically placed throughout a building. When a fire is identified, the heat causes the sprinkler heads in the immediate area, launching water or specialized fire reductions representatives to control the flames.
Exactly How Do Fire Sprinklers Detect Fire?
Fire sprinkler heads are outfitted with a heat-sensitive element, typically a glass light bulb loaded with a fluid that expands when exposed to high temperatures. When the temperature level gets to a details threshold (usually in between 135 ° F and 165 ° F), the glass light bulb ruptureds, permitting water to move through the sprinkler head and onto the fire.
Unlike smoke detectors, which are triggered by smoke particles, fire sprinklers activate only in action to warm. This makes certain that duds brought on by food preparation smoke or vapor do not lead to unneeded water release.
Types of Fire Sprinkler Systems
There are several types of fire sprinkler systems, each designed for various applications and settings. Understanding which system fits your property best is essential for reliable fire defense.
Wet Pipe Sprinkler System
The most common sort of fire automatic sprinkler is the wet pipe system, which has water in the pipelines whatsoever times. When a sprinkler head is activated by warmth, water is promptly discharged. This kind is suitable for office buildings, resorts, and houses.
Dry Pipe Sprinkler System
In areas where freezing temperature levels are an issue, a completely dry pipe system is extra efficient. Instead of water, these systems have pressurized air or nitrogen in the pipes. When a sprinkler head turns on, the air is released, permitting water to flow with and suppress the fire.
Pre-Action Sprinkler System
Pre-action systems need 2 triggers prior to releasing water. First, a fire discovery system must find a fire, and then the heat-sensitive sprinkler head need to turn on. These systems are typically made use of in information centers, museums, and collections, where accidental water discharge could trigger substantial damage.
Foam Water Sprinkler System
A foam water sprinkler system combines water with a fire-suppressing foam concentrate, developing a blanket that surrounds the fires and protects against reignition. This system is especially valuable in facilities that save flammable liquids or unsafe materials, as the foam subdues fires more effectively than water alone.

Maintaining Your Fire Sprinkler System
A fire automatic sprinkler is only reliable if properly kept. Routine examinations and maintenance aid guarantee that the system operates properly when required. Routine checks must consist of:
- Inspecting sprinkler heads for damage or clogs
- Checking water pressure degrees
- Ensuring control valves are open and functional
- Testing alarm signals and back-up systems
